Plant Habit: | Shrub |
Life cycle: | Perennial |
Sun Requirements: | Full Sun to Partial Shade |
Water Preferences: | Mesic |
Soil pH Preferences: | Moderately acid (5.6 – 6.0) Slightly acid (6.1 – 6.5) |
Minimum cold hardiness: | Zone 3 -40 °C (-40 °F) to -37.2 °C (-35) |
Maximum recommended zone: | Zone 8b |
Plant Height: | 4 to 8 feet, possibly 15 feet |
Plant Spread: | 4 to 8 feet |
Leaves: | Deciduous |
Fruit: | Dehiscent Other: 1/2 inch long hairy capsules containing yellowish-brown to brown winged seeds. |
Flowers: | Showy Fragrant |
Flower Color: | Pink |
Bloom Size: | 1"-2" |
Flower Time: | Spring Late spring or early summer |
Uses: | Cut Flower |
Wildlife Attractant: | Bees Butterflies Hummingbirds |
Resistances: | Rabbit Resistant |
Toxicity: | Other: All parts of plant are highly toxic. |
Propagation: Other methods: | Cuttings: Tip Layering Other: Tissue Culture |
